Handcrafted gourmet pizza chain PizzaExpress has opened its new outlet in Hyderabad.

GIPL plans to open 100+ PizzaExpress stores over the next few years.

PizzaExpress is known for its handcrafted gourmet pizzas, using the finest ingredients that is available in two bases; one, the 1965 Original Traditional Pizza with the “Classic” Base and the other; the thinner, crispier “Romana” base inspired by pizzas from Rome.

In addition to Pizzas there is a healthy variety of Pastas, and appetizers along with delectable cheesecakes (available in 6 different flavours) and other desserts plus fresh Italian coffee which makes every PizzaExpress meal special.

Other speciality products include signature Dough balls served with a trio of dips & speciality Pizzas like Calabrese - our iconic rectangular Pizza (invented by the Michelin start Chef), Leggera - Pizza under 600 calories & Calzone – The folded Pizza.

All products are available in Dine-in, Delivery & Take away channels.

Inspired by a trip to Italy, founder Peter Boizot opened the first PizzaExpress in Wardour Street, London in 1965. Today, there are 400+ restaurants across the globe, serving signature handcrafted gourmet pizzas.

PizzaExpress was brought to India by Gourmet Investments Private Limited (GIPL), which is the F&B venture of Bharti Family office. The first PizzaExpress opened in India in the year 2012 in Colaba, Mumbai. Currently there are 18 restaurants across 6 cities in India.
